Rock-Tenn has a WARN Act filing history stretching from November 2008 to October 2012, with 4 notices affecting 354 employees in total. Filings are concentrated in Pennsylvania (1) and Ohio (1), with additional notices across 2 other states. Notices include 2 layoffs and 2 facility closures. There have been no new filings in the past 12 months.

Under the WARN Act (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ification Act), employers with 100 or more employees are required to provide 60 days advance notice before conducting plant closures or mass layoffs. These notices are filed with state labor departments and are public record.
